Had a chance to run down an airstrip last month and hit 171mph several times. Next month I will running an even longer airstrip. Anyone know how to stop the rear spoiler from deploying at 74 MPH? Fuse maybe? Hoping to hit 180+ and I'm sure that spoiler is costing me several MPH. Any help or advice would be appreciated.

I hit 171 running 70% of a mile on an airstrip, I had posted a vid in a previous post if you would like to check it out...fun day :-) AMG17GT...does your spoiler button lower it at higher speeds? Mine sure doesn't, but mine is a 16. It just raises it while parked or below 74 mph. Owners manual says its just to raise for cleaning it. The engineers def know their stuff for the track, however this is a straight line speed run. I don't need the down force, that's why ultra performance cars, have active spoilers and suspensions that lower at higher speeds. I think the wing software has to be electronically altered because it goes up and stays up at speed for "safety" reasons. I know guys were looking into this to add aftermarket or Aero Package wings to the cars. I think RennTech may have a solution, but that is probably provided in connection with buying their package. You may want to check with them since you are a customer.
Careful here. What you gain by losing some drag, but be lost with instability at those speeds. Be safe.

Thanks guys and valid points. I plan to do a few exploratory runs working up to a full speed run. At those speeds, a tire issue would probably be a higher risk. Would love to be able to figure this out.
Also noticed tonight if I hold down the spoiler button for about 5 seconds at speeds above 74 MPH. the spoiler WILL go down, but then it pops back up about 5 seconds later.
